          "Chris Stead" <[email protected]> wrote in message
          news:[email protected]...
          > Kumar,
          >
          > Look inside the ear file of the TIBCO Adapter. Find the name of the rar
          > file. When creating your application, make sure you name the
          > application the same name as the rar file. So, using the RDBMS adapter
          > as an example:
          >
          > ear file: BEA_RDBMS_1_0_70.ear
          > rar file: BEA_RDBMS_1_0.rar
          >
          > When I upload the ear file while creating an application, the
          > application name will default to the name of the ear file
          > (BEA_RDBMS_1_0_70). However, due to legacy logic within the AI portion
          > of WLI, the code expects to see BEA_RDBMS_1_0 as that is the name of the
          > rar file. Once the application name corresponds with the rar file name,
          > your adapter will appear in the drop down list during Application View
          > creation.
          >
          > Cheers,
          > Chris

    Monkeyboy,
    That was quite a bit to read, but still a bit unclear. Could you put a specific list of goals/questions, asked in the smallest possible form?
    It seems like either you're making a program that monitors activity on your computer, or you're writing some kind of remote pc app.
    When you do get your bytes from using lockbits, keep in mind all the files header info would be lost. I think retaining the header info is worth the extra bytes.
    The other, thing: I'm not sure if you're taking 32bpp screen shots, but also keep in mind that the "whole desktop" is the final destination for blended graphics, if that makes sense. What I mean is that there is no need to capture an "alpha"
    channel for a desktop screenshot, as alpha would always be 255, this could save you 1 byte per pixel captured... Theres nothing "behind" the desktop, therefore no alpha, and every window shown above the desktop is already blended. I suggest using
    24Bpp for a full screen capture.
    Your X,Y information for the mouse could be stored as UINT16, this would save you a measly 2 bytes per location update/save.
    When you update your byte arrays, maybe you can turn the array into a stream and write to whatever index, however many bytes, that should prevent a "Shift" of bytes, and instead overwrite any bytes that "get in the way".
    ex
    Dim example As String = "This is an example."
    Dim insertString As String = "was"
    Dim insertBytes As Byte() = System.Text.Encoding.ASCII.GetBytes(insertString)
    Dim bytes As Byte() = System.Text.Encoding.ASCII.GetBytes(example)
    Dim modifiedBytes As Byte() = {}
    Using ms As New System.IO.MemoryStream(bytes)
    ms.Position = 5
    ms.Write(insertBytes, 0, 3)
    modifiedBytes = ms.ToArray
    End Using
    Dim newString As String = System.Text.Encoding.ASCII.GetString(modifiedBytes)
    'Notice how below there isn't the word "is" anymore, and that there isn't a
    'space.
    'This demonstrates that you overwrite existing data, versus shifting everything to
    'the right.
    'Returns: This wasan example.
    MsgBox(newString)

  • How to update weblogic.properties in order to support English & Chinese

    <URGENT PROBLEM>
    hi,
    how to update weblogic.properties in order to support English & Chinese
    version in a sing weblogic server?
    Thanks in advance
    <URGENT PROBLEM>

    If you are using JSP as your mechanism for content display, you should use
    the contentType parameter to specify the character and coding of the JSP
    page any character encoding of the resulting stream. So far, we have not
    done a good job of documenting how to produce localized content in JSP. I
    have filed an issue for the documentation folks to work on it. For now,
    take a look at section 2.7.4 of the JSP specification version 1.1.
    Thanks,
    Michael
